The National Council imposed sanctions against Inter because of the songs of Kobzon, a symbol of Russia
Kyiv, January 15 (PolitNavigator, Victoria Litovchenko) – The National Council for Television and Radio Broadcasting of Ukraine issued a warning to the Inter TV channel for broadcasting a concert with the participation of Russian performers on New Year’s Eve.

“The decision of the National Council for Inter is to issue a warning and conduct an inspection. Unanimously. After an appeal from the Secretary of the National Security and Defense Council and representatives of public organizations. We will further strengthen responsibility through legislation. If the media makes Ukrainian-haters and symbols of the occupier’s country into cultural heroes, placing them on the prime of the year or even on the air,” Verkhovna Rada deputy Victoria Syumar wrote on her Facebook page.
As BBC Ukraine reports, the corresponding decision was made as a result of many hours of discussions. According to the National Council, the Russian performers shown by the channel “incited hostility, encroached on territorial integrity and supported the annexation of Crimea.”
Member of the National Council Ekaterina Kotenko explained that a warning is a sanction that is imposed on the channel. Receiving three warnings gives the National Council the right to sue to deprive the channel of its license.
The National Council also decided to conduct an unscheduled inspection of compliance with the law on the channels “Inter”, ICTV, “Tonis”, “Ukraine”. In addition, all broadcasters were recommended to “refrain from broadcasting persons who encroach on the integrity of Ukraine.”
As PolitNavigator reported, in early January “Svobodovite” Alexey Kurinnoy demanded to influence “Inter” for showing Russian artists – Joseph Kobzon, Oleg Gazmanov and others on New Year’s Eve. The head of the National Security and Defense Council, Alexander Turchynov, called Inter’s New Year’s night broadcast “a mockery of the entire country.” The Minister of Culture of Ukraine Vyacheslav Kirilenko called for “cutting off the Inter button.” Minister of Information of Ukraine Yuriy Stets initiated a ban on the appearance in Ukrainian media of persons who are prohibited from entering Ukraine.
